当前位置: 首页> 技术文档> 正文

如何监控网站的页面加载速度?

在当今数字化的时代,网站的页面加载速度对于用户体验和搜索引擎排名都起着至关重要的作用。一个加载缓慢的网站可能会导致用户流失、降低转化率,并影响网站在搜索引擎结果页面中的排名。因此,监控网站的页面加载速度是网站管理和优化的重要环节。本文将介绍一些有效的方法来监控网站的页面加载速度。

一、使用在线工具

1. Google PageSpeed Insights:这是 Google 提供的一款免费工具,它可以对网站的页面加载速度进行评估,并提供详细的优化建议。通过输入网站的 URL,PageSpeed Insights 将分析页面的性能,并给出诸如优化图像、减少 HTTP 请求等方面的建议。

2. GTmetrix:GTmetrix 是另一个常用的网站加载速度监控工具,它不仅可以评估页面的加载速度,还可以提供页面加载时间的详细分解,包括 DNS 查询、请求队列、服务器响应时间等。GTmetrix 还可以生成性能报告,方便网站管理员进行分析和优化。

3. WebPageTest:WebPageTest 是一个功能强大的网站加载速度测试工具,它可以模拟不同的网络环境和设备,对网站的加载速度进行全面的测试。通过 WebPageTest,网站管理员可以了解到网站在不同条件下的加载情况,并根据测试结果进行针对性的优化。

二、设置服务器日志分析

1. Apache Log Analyzer:如果网站使用 Apache 服务器,那么可以使用 Apache Log Analyzer 来分析服务器日志。通过分析日志文件,管理员可以了解到用户访问网站的时间、页面请求情况、响应时间等信息,从而发现网站加载速度方面的问题。

2. Nginx Log Analyzer:对于使用 Nginx 服务器的网站,也可以使用相应的日志分析工具来监控网站的加载速度。这些工具可以帮助管理员快速定位服务器响应时间较长的页面,并进行优化。

三、使用浏览器开发工具

1. Chrome DevTools:Chrome 浏览器的开发者工具是监控网站加载速度的强大工具之一。通过打开开发者工具,管理员可以查看页面的加载时间、资源加载情况、网络请求等信息。在 Network 标签页中,管理员可以看到每个资源的加载时间和请求大小,从而找出加载缓慢的资源并进行优化。

2. Firefox Developer Tools:Firefox 浏览器也提供了类似的开发者工具,其中的 Network 面板可以帮助管理员监控网站的加载速度。Firefox 还提供了一些其他的性能测试工具,如 Page Performance 和 Performance Monitor,方便管理员进行更深入的分析。

四、定期进行性能测试

1. 制定测试计划:制定一个定期的性能测试计划,例如每周或每月进行一次全面的性能测试。在测试计划中,确定要测试的页面和测试的环境,以便能够准确地评估网站的加载速度。

2. 分析测试结果:每次进行性能测试后,要仔细分析测试结果,找出加载速度方面的问题,并制定相应的优化措施。可以将测试结果与之前的测试结果进行比较,以评估优化措施的效果。

五、优化网站代码和资源

1. 压缩和合并文件:对网站的 CSS、JavaScript 和图像文件进行压缩和合并,减少文件的大小,从而加快页面的加载速度。可以使用一些工具如 YUI Compressor、CSS Compressor 等进行文件压缩。

2. 优化图像:优化图像的大小和质量,选择合适的图像格式,如 JPEG、PNG 或 GIF,并使用图片压缩工具进行优化。避免使用过大的图像,以免影响页面的加载速度。

3. 减少 HTTP 请求:减少页面中的 HTTP 请求数量,例如合并 CSS 和 JavaScript 文件、使用 CSS Sprites 等。每个 HTTP 请求都会增加页面的加载时间,因此减少请求数量可以显著提高页面的加载速度。

4. 优化数据库查询:如果网站使用数据库,要优化数据库查询,减少查询时间。可以使用索引、优化查询语句等方法来提高数据库的性能。

六、监控和优化服务器性能

1. 选择合适的服务器:根据网站的访问量和需求,选择合适的服务器配置,包括服务器类型、内存、硬盘等。确保服务器具有足够的性能来处理用户的请求。

2. 优化服务器配置:对服务器进行优化配置,例如设置合适的缓存、调整连接池大小、优化数据库连接等。这些优化措施可以提高服务器的响应速度和并发处理能力。

3. 监控服务器性能:使用监控工具来实时监控服务器的性能,如 CPU 使用率、内存使用率、磁盘 I/O 等。及时发现服务器性能问题,并采取相应的措施进行优化。

监控网站的页面加载速度是网站管理和优化的重要任务。通过使用在线工具、设置服务器日志分析、使用浏览器开发工具、定期进行性能测试以及优化网站代码和资源等方法,可以有效地监控和优化网站的加载速度,提高用户体验和搜索引擎排名。同时,要持续关注网站的性能变化,及时调整优化措施,以确保网站始终保持良好的加载速度。

Copyright©2018-2025 版权归属 浙江花田网络有限公司 逗号站长站 www.douhao.com
本站已获得《中华人民共和国增值电信业务经营许可证》:浙B2-20200940 浙ICP备18032409号-1 浙公网安备 33059102000262号